Outcomes

The Department of Social Work plays an important role in helping students meet the five major competencies of Gallaudet's new General Studies Curriculum:

  • Language and Communication
  • Critical Thinking
  • Identity and Culture
  • Knowledge and Inquiry
  • Ethics and Social Responsibility

Careers

What can I do with a Social Work degree?

A bachelor's degree in social work gives you a solid foundation to pursue a higher degree in the field, as well as to pursue these career fields:

  • Case management
  • Child welfare
  • Children and youth services
  • Community advocacy
  • Criminal justice
  • Deaf services
  • Domestic violence
  • Dormitory and residential counseling
  • Geriatric services
  • Health
  • Human services advocacy
  • Independent living services
  • Legislative aid
  • Mental health
  • Probation and parole
  • School social work
  • Substance abuse counseling
  • Vocational rehabilitation counseling
  • Youth counseling
  • Youth programs
